Senior Mechanical Design Engineer - Flexible Instruments
Intuitive is a pioneer and market leader in robotic-assisted surgery, committed to minimally invasive care. The Senior Mechanical Design Engineer will support the design and testing of next-generation robotic flexible instruments, focusing on developing new components and ensuring robust data backing for designs.

Responsibilities
Design new instrument components, using knowledge and experience to select the optimal material and process (metal vs. plastic, molded vs. extruded vs. MIM vs. formed, etc.)
Develop test methods, fixtures, and measurement tools to evaluate the performance of robotic catheters and sub-assemblies
Benchmark existing designs and compare candidate designs
Present your findings to design engineering, clinical, and manufacturing, and make recommendations for design iterations
Work with clinical engineering and manufacturing to understand key drivers of product performance, durability, and ease of assembly
Investigate and determine root cause of emerging design or manufacturing defects
Help define engineering requirements and ensure candidate designs are backed by robust data prior to design freeze
Complete detailed drawings and robust tolerance analysis and update designs accordingly
Support process development engineering activities
Mentor and guide younger engineers about best practices in design and engineering
